Internal fixation is a surgical technique used to stabilize and secure fractured bones or joints during the healing process. This method involves the use of various devices such as plates, screws, rods, or pins that are implanted inside the body to hold the fractured ends of the bones in alignment. By providing strong and stable support, internal fixation allows for early mobilization of the affected limb, reducing the risk of complications such as joint stiffness and muscle atrophy. The primary goal of internal fixation is to promote proper healing while restoring the anatomical structure and function of the bones. Unlike external fixation, which uses external devices to stabilize fractures, internal fixation is entirely contained within the body, thus minimizing the risk of infection and improving patient comfort. The choice of internal fixation method depends on several factors, including the type and location of the fracture, the patient's age, activity level, and overall health. For instance, in the case of complex fractures or those involving joints, surgeons may choose a combination of plates and screws to achieve optimal stabilization. The use of intramedullary nails is another form of internal fixation frequently employed in long bone fractures, where a rod is inserted into the bone marrow canal to provide support. Internal fixation not only enhances the biological healing process but also allows for improved alignment, significantly influencing functional outcomes and reducing the time required for rehabilitation. After surgery, patients are typically monitored closely for signs of complications and may need physical therapy to regain strength and mobility. Overall, internal fixation is a vital component of modern orthopedic practices, enabling surgeons to effectively treat fractures and restore quality of life for patients. Despite its advantages, internal fixation carries certain risks, including infection, bleeding, and complications arising from the hardware used. Surgeons carefully consider these factors when planning surgery, aiming to maximize benefits while minimizing potential drawbacks. Post-operative care is crucial, as it involves regular follow-ups, imaging studies to assess bone healing, and adjustments in rehabilitation protocols to accommodate the patient's recovery progress. The development of advanced materials and minimally invasive techniques has further enhanced the effectiveness and safety of internal fixation procedures, contributing to improved patient outcomes and satisfaction.
